So long independent music radio, Nashville

The Nashville Scene is reporting that 91.1 WRVU (Vanderbilt’s independent college radio station) has been acquired by classical music station WPLN and will become Classical 91 One (WFCL).  It will offer classical music all day, every day freeing WPLN to pursue all-NPR programming.
